Peter Lion was inclined towards writing at a very young age. During his growing up years in Connecticut he was seen dabbling in poetry and also wrote numerous short stories. His talent within this field was further honed when after enrolling in the Notre Dame High School in Connecticut he soon began contributing to the students school newspaper.
He set out to make a career of his passion for the words by first getting a degree in Journalism from the Southern Connecticut State University. He printed his first magazine article inside the Hartford Magazine before he had graduated with his journalism degree.
He entered into the television business even before he’d completed his college. A few months before graduation, Peter Lion took up a job with WTNH-TV as part time graphics operator. This television channel was an affiliate of the ABC network and was based out of New Haven. Peter Lion though, had no knowledge of this field snapped up this chance to get an entry and to develop a foothold in the news and tv industry.
He learned the ropes rapidly, understanding the technicalities of the workings of the television network and remained a part of the channel for more than a time period of two years.
Then he moved to Boston and started working together with WSBK as a Technical Director. He labored on several projects, his major one being the Boston Red Sox Baseball and Boston Bruins Hockey. However, his desire to be in television with the exceptional passion for writing pulled him back to his home state as a part of a small television station start up.
He signed up with this team to be a director and a technical director with the 10 PM news cast, that was to be the very first within the state. He grabbed this opportunity of showcasing his talent and knowledge as with his stint in Boston he’s had the capacity of working together with several accomplished directors. He used this understanding to develop the show from scratch.
Peter Lion moved to Pittsburg and joined KADA TV after completing two years in this start-up. As part of his stint in this television network, he exploited the various facets of his expertise and worked as a weather anchor, announcer, news producer, feature producer and director. It had been throughout his stint at KADA-TV that Peter Lion found inspiration for his book titled The American St. Nick”.
He then moved back in Connecticut and became a part of ESPN sports network. Still a part of ESPN, he’s responsible for a variety of their shows like Sports Centre as well as the NFL Draft as part of his position within the organization as a Director. His primary show however, remains, College Gameday.
He has been a 2 time winner of the Emmy awards, although he has been nominated frequently for his contribution while in the television industry. He got his first Emmy for his work with Sports Centre and received his second Emmy for the show NFL countdown.
Besides working, Peter Lion is presently working on his 2nd book. He’s also a part of a band that goes by the name of Cheaper than Therapy” and is its lead singer and guitarist
